We know dinosaurs like Spinosaurus and Baryonyx had elongated snouts because they lived by (or in) rivers and hunted fish. The evolutionary motivation for Qianzhousaurus' schnozz is a bit more uncertain since this late Cretaceous dinosaur appears to have subsisted exclusively on terrestrial prey.
